I am trying to create a rescue disk from the Comodo Backup software on my windows But it shows a message to “Downoad and install windows Automated Installation Kit. When I click on download button in the application, it goes to the windows 7 download page. Kindly help. As far as I know, there is no Rescue Disk installation package for Windows Ok, then what do I do in Windows 10?
When I try to create a comodo rescue disk in my windows 10 system, it ask to download and install the windows AIK. How do I restore the system from the backup without the rescue disk? Until Comodo provides an update and support for Windows 10, the Rescue Disk may not be compatible. You may want to seek an alternate software solution at the present time for backup services. To restore your system you would have to re-install Windows, then install Comodo, then do a restore although a full c: restore would obviously be overwriting files that were in use. Alternatively you can use the Windows 10 inbuilt facilities to create an system image and a restore disc.
I suppose you could then use Comodo to restore differences from the image but quite how you would work that out is an interesting question. I think the confusion comes from the Comodo Backup option to create a rescue disc. That could be interpreted to either create a rescue disc to scan for malware or to create a rescue disc to boot and restore a system, since it is linked from the Backup program.
